Manuel Rosso Raises $2M from AV

Manuel Rosso, formerly of Dell’s desktop group and IMVU Inc., a social media startup (co-founded by guru Eric Ries) has raised $2 million from Austin Ventures, the Statesman’s Lori Hawkins reports.

The new company was incubated at AV over the last year, where Rosso served as an Entrepreneur-In-Residence.

Austin Startup can additionally confirm that Rosso has hired ex-FiveRuns VP of Development and Technology Steve Sanderson as the VP of Product of the new company.

Sanderson has a reputation for guiding especially simple and elegant products, as well as the care and feeding of Ruby developers. At FiveRuns he recruited and managed and truly top-notch group, and it is reasonable to expect to see a few notable Rails hires for the new venture in the coming weeks and months.

The investment is one of a select few early stage, consumer-facing investments that AV has since announcing its new $900 million fund. Other recent portfolio company additions in this vein include Crimereports.com, Jigsaw, Slacker and Workstreamer.
